Habib Beye, coach of the first team, must have been delighted with the performance of Sébastien Tambouret's players, especially when he saw the intensity shown by Rennes to compensate for the difference in maturity against a Nantes side that was more like a Youth League team.
Despite the difference in level that was feared before kick-off, Rennes had what it took to overcome Nantes, adding a little luck to the mix, as captain Henrick Do Marcolino opened the scoring in the 4th minute with a shot from outside the box that was slightly deflected, enough to beat the goalkeeper. Stanislas Natiez was beaten a second time at the very end, powerless to stop Steeve Mvodo's penalty shot into the top corner after 95 minutes of a battle worthy of a derby.

Sébastien Tambouret's reaction
"A derby is never a trivial match. And the Challenge Espoirs is another dimension altogether; we give it a different level of importance. We love this competition because it offers an intensity and adversity that we don't necessarily encounter every weekend. Here, we understand why it was set up; it brings us closer to what exists a little higher up.
We were up against a team that is used to playing in the Youth League, the Champions League for young players. They are athletic and play with a lot of intensity. We had to at least match that level, which we were able to do for 55 minutes. Then they took the upper hand, but we were brave and showed solidarity without retreating too much. We also wanted to be proactive in case there were spaces left behind to go for a second goal, which we did well. We also needed talent to win this match, and we achieved our objectives."
